The High Power Rectifier (HPR) Business Unit, part of the Process Industries Division, operates globally and delivers large‑scale projects across the full project lifecycle. The HPR unit designs and manufactures customized rectifier systems for aluminum smelting, electric steel, and chemical industry applications.

As a Senior Transformer Specialist for High Power Rectifiers, you will apply your technical expertise to support Engineering, R&D, and Supply Chain Management on transformer‑related topics.

Your Responsibilities

Provide technical guidance in transformer sourcing during the sales phase. Assist in the preparation of technical bids and tender documents, ensuring that all transformer-related aspects are accurately addressed and compliant with client requirements and industry standards. Be capable of performing technical comparisons between different transformer suppliers based on key technical parameters such as losses and dimensions.

Engineering Consultation & Guidance

Support engineering in the review of transformer specifications. Review various transformer analyses such as electrostatic shield analysis, short-circuit withstand analysis, hot-spot calculation reports, and thermal evaluations, and provide technical advice to the factory based on these calculations. Provide expert support during active part inspections and FAT. Actively lead transformer design review meetings. Support transformer troubleshooting activities. For example, be capable of interpreting DGA analysis results and providing recommendations for possible service actions and post-mortem analysis.

R&D

Contribute to R&D projects by conducting feasibility studies involving special transformers for different AC and DC power electronics topologies. Propose specific transformer designs for high-current AC and DC applications.

Lead Technical Customer Meetings

Demonstrate transformer expertise during customer meetings to create a competitive advantage. Lead product demonstrations and presentations, highlighting the performance, reliability, and efficiency of transformer solutions in the context of the client’s project needs.

Risk Assessment

Evaluate and communicate potential risks associated with transformer integration within specific projects, advising on mitigation strategies and alternative solutions where necessary.

SCM

Support SCM in the qualification and development of transformer suppliers.

Key Requirements

To be successful in this role, you bring a Master’s or PhD degree in Electrical Engineering and more than five years of proven experience in transformer technology. You have strong expertise in transformer design for various AC and/or DC power electronics applications and a comprehensive understanding of thermal and mechanical transformer design, as well as their manufacturing processes.

You possess professional experience in performing simulations and have a solid understanding of applicable transformer standards. You demonstrate strong theoretical and practical expertise in converter transformers, power transformers, and autotransformers.
